ASPEN seminar series: Guiding your Successor – The Good, The Bad, The Ugly

Guiding a potential successor can be difficult. This discussion will highlight a list of variables that can support both parties navigating a mentoring relationship. Emotional intelligence, defining goals and organic versus forced connections will be explored. The conversations’ goal is to view these relationships realistically, define common barriers to successful outcomes and use tools to facilitate evaluation of compatibility.

Presented by:
Elda Ramirez, PhD, RN, FNP-BC, ENP-C, FAAEN, FAANP, FAAN
Assistant Dean for Diversity, Equity and Inclusion, Cizik School of Nursing, UT Health Houston

Dr. Elda Ramirez is the Dorothy T. Nicholson Distinguished Professor in the Cizik School of Nursing at UTHealth Houston. She also serves as the Assistant Dean for Diversity, Equity and Inclusion (DEI) at Cizik and inaugural Chair of the UTHealth System Diversity Equity and Inclusion Council, which is made up of faculty, staff and students. These roles are newly established allowing Dr. Ramirez to influence the development of an infrastructure that will serve as the launching pad for the institutions inclusive DEI initiative. In her new roles she is responsible for being an innovator, sounding board and voice for faculty, staff and students across a world-renowned health science center, encompassing six schools (medical, dental, public health, graduate studies, biomedical informatics and nursing). Dr. Ramirez is the co-chair of the American Association of Colleges of Nursing (AACN) DEI Leadership Network Communications Committee and was chosen to be a member of the 2022 AACN Diversity Leadership Institute.
